Curve 78400gx3

78400 = 26 · 52 · 72



Data for elliptic curve 78400gx3

Field Data Notes
Atkin-Lehner 2- 5+ 7- Signs for the Atkin-Lehner involutions
Class 78400gx Isogeny class
Conductor 78400 Conductor
∏ cp 16 Product of Tamagawa factors cp
Δ -75295360000000000 = -1 · 216 · 510 · 76 Discriminant
Eigenvalues 2-  0 5+ 7-  4  2  2 -4 Hecke eigenvalues for primes up to 20
Equation [0,0,0,63700,-11662000] [a1,a2,a3,a4,a6]
Generators [5546805:48840625:35937] Generators of the group modulo torsion
j 237276/625 j-invariant
L 6.8586656162156 L(r)(E,1)/r!
Ω 0.17742122562873 Real period
R 9.6643814599975 Regulator
r 1 Rank of the group of rational points
S 1.0000000002785 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 78400w3 19600i4 15680dk4 1600p4 Quadratic twists by: -4 8 5 -7
